The genes cryIAc and cryIIAb protect cotton against:

ACaterpillars
BBollworms
CLeafhoppers
DGrasshoppers
Answer & Solution
Correct answer: B. Bollworms
1. Each cry gene suits a particular pest group. 2. These two are put into cotton plants. 3. They control the cotton bollworms. _Source: NCERT Class 12 Biology, Ch 10 'Biotechnology and its Applications'_
